永发信息网

类和接口的异同点。

答案:2  悬赏:50  手机版
解决时间 2021-03-26 02:04
类和接口的异同点。
最佳答案
声明方法的存在而不去实现它的类被叫做抽象类(abstract class),它用于要创建一个体现某些基本行为的类,并为该类声明方法,但不能在该类中实现该类的情况。不能创建abstract 类的实例。然而可以创建一个变量,其类型是一个抽象类,并让它指向具体子类的一个实例。不能有抽象构造函数或抽象静态方法。Abstract 类的子类为它们父类中的所有抽象方法提供实现,否则它们也是抽象类。取而代之,在子类中实现该方法。知道其行为的其它类可以在类中实现这些方法。

接口(interface)是抽象类的变体。在接口中,所有方法都是抽象的。多继承性可通过实现这样的接口而获得。接口中的所有方法都是抽象的,没有一个有程序体。接口只可以定义static final成员变量。接口的实现与子类相似,除了该实现类不能从接口定义中继承行为。当类实现特殊接口时,它定义(即将程序体给予)所有这种接口的方法。然后,它可以在实现了该接口的类的任何对象上调用接口的方法。由于有抽象类,它允许使用接口名作为引用变量的类型。通常的动态联编将生效。引用可以转换到接口类型或从接口类型转换,instanceof 运算符可以用来决定某对象的类是否实现了接口。
全部回答
好好看看课本,查查资料,但那些都是书本上的
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
弱电工程概算,应该包括那些具体内容?
转换硬盘格式会损坏文件吗?
√28×28+16×16≈ ?
3名台湾游客三峡遇难湖北宜昌准备怎么做?
青春期对比,我是男生,相对比一下那个东东
市场常见的饮料热灌装的多吗
西宁当地哪个旅行社好
早上几点吃饭最好!最好吃什么?
清代美学思想的代表人物
剑网3怎么由第一人称视角转为第三人称视角 谢
100元尾号123333的有收藏价值吗
11/13×3分之2-7/33乘以十三分之十一
男人是不是都很绝情?分手后就一定不会和好了
梦见隔着内裤看见男人的阴经勃起好高什么意思
如何打造一个引爆全网的事件营销
推荐资讯
英雄联盟装备
ps里降噪是什么意思 在哪里设置
景逸x51.8t和1,6的变速箱一样吗
慈溪人籍贯是什么
能不能借我1500 一个星期后还 到时候还2000
为什么在IPAD上看不到验证码
广西百色最好的夜店是?
安康附近或者汉中附近10.1后有什么好的休闲度
工作调动,是在公安局好还是去市人大好
平时男朋友是很老实可靠的人 同居2年 每天下
纸箱破裂强度
有什么比较适合日常听的日语podcast
正方形一边上任一点到这个正方形两条对角线的
阴历怎么看 ?